IDF Chief Says Hezbollah Must Be Removed South of Litani

IDF Chief of Staff Lt. Gen. Eyal Zamir said during a visit to the Northern Command's 91st Division that Israel is determined to remove Hezbollah's presence south of the Litani River and prevent the group from rebuilding. He said a diplomatic arrangement with Lebanon could not advance that objective unless the Lebanese Armed Forces significantly improved its performance on the ground. Zamir approved the division's defensive principles, ordered troops to maintain high readiness and reviewed robotic systems presented by field-intelligence, Yahalom and reserve units. He also said the IDF plans to inaugurate a Robotics Branch in the coming months.
